In this quick, real-life "car chat" episode, I share the single biggest freedom hack I've discovered after nearly a decade as a stay-at-home mom of three littles. If you're a stay-at-home or work-from-home mom feeling overwhelmed by constant demands, sensory overload, and power struggles, this episode is for you.
I dive into why getting out of the house alone, even for just 10 minutes a day, is a game-changer for your mental health and feeling grounded. I share honestly about my early-morning spin class routine, the benefits of reclaiming autonomy, and the emotional relief it brings. You'll hear how stepping outside, leaving mom duties behind, and soaking in your own quiet time can reduce resentment, recharge your soul, and boost your parenting patience.
If you've ever felt guilty for craving alone time or believe self-care means grand gestures, this episode encourages you to rethink that. Your mental health as a mom matters—not just as fuel for others, but because you're worthy of care simply for being you.
